Karima Mehrab, a refugee from the Balochistan area of western Pakistan who was also referred to as Karima Baloch, went lacking on Sunday in Toronto’s downtown waterfront space. Police stated her physique was found on Monday.
Mehrab was a distinguished pupil organizer who campaigned for Balochistan’s separation from Pakistan, and later fled to Canada amid threats. She was named one of many BBC’s 100 inspirational and influential girls of 2016.
Toronto police supplied few particulars about her demise. Mike Butt, a detective, stated by telephone: “It has been deemed a non-criminal incident.”
Earlier this 12 months Sajid Hussain, a Balochistan journalist and activist residing in exile in Sweden, was found drowned there, in accordance with media experiences.
